- No batch jobs available, wait for batch job to be available ?The SAP error message
/SMB/IMPORT_EXPORT157 No batch jobs available, wait for batch job to be available
typically occurs in the context of batch processing, particularly when using the SAP Business One or SAP Business Suite systems. This error indicates that there are no available batch jobs to process the request at the moment.Cause:
- No Available Batch Jobs: The system is unable to find any batch jobs that can be executed at the time of the request. This could be due to all available batch jobs being occupied or in a waiting state.
- Job Scheduling Issues: There may be issues with the job scheduling configuration, leading to a lack of available jobs.
- System Load: High system load or resource contention may prevent batch jobs from being processed in a timely manner.
- Configuration Settings: The configuration settings for batch job processing may not be set up correctly, leading to insufficient job availability.
Solution:
- Check Batch Job Status: Use transaction codes like
SM37
to check the status of batch jobs. Look for any jobs that are currently running or in a waiting state.- Increase Batch Job Capacity: If the system is consistently running out of batch jobs, consider increasing the number of batch jobs that can run concurrently. This can be done in the system configuration settings.
- Review Job Scheduling: Ensure that the job scheduling is set up correctly and that there are no conflicts or misconfigurations.
- Monitor System Performance: Check the overall system performance and resource utilization. If the system is under heavy load, consider optimizing performance or scheduling jobs during off-peak hours.
- Restart Batch Processing: Sometimes, simply restarting the batch processing or the application server can resolve temporary issues.
-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es or patches that may address this issue.
